Sarah Citron co-founded Bricoleur Vineyards with her parents after a career in the New York fashion industry. As COO, she leads hospitality and operations while continuing her great-great-grandfather Pietro Carlo Rossi’s winemaking legacy. He was the original oenologist in the 19th century for Sonoma’s Italian Swiss Colony.

It might be surprising to learn that a driving impetus behind Sonoma County wine venture Patz & Hall Winery bloomed in Santa Cruz in the late 1970s. Founder and owner James Hall was a UCSC slug back then, and a sip of wine he took at the restaurant he worked in served as a lightbulb moment. Fast forward a few decades to 2024, when Hall reclaimed the label’s legacy by repurchasing the winery following eight years as part of Ste. Michelle Wine Estates’ corporate portfolio.

On a stretch of coastline often skipped over on the way to or from San Diego, Carlsbad is a mellow and welcoming destination. Famous for its Flower Fields at Carlsbad Ranch, a 55-acre farm of giant tecolote ranunculus that bloom March through May, the “Village by the Sea” is perfect for a spring visit. With direct one-and-a-half-hour flights to San Diego from Oakland Airport, the trip is an easy one for visitors from the East Bay.
